Transaction aad91b16496c86fab4b4c5d51bf3e314a2fc83f4ea338894686f869ecebb117a
1 Input
2 Outputs
- aad91b16496c86fab4b4c5d51bf3e314a2fc83f4ea338894686f869ecebb117a:0
- aad91b16496c86fab4b4c5d51bf3e314a2fc83f4ea338894686f869ecebb117a:1
value 4209604
address 1N4AVSozKzzLoS9Tu43G2swm8yfgYALK3A
value 21294500
address 1DXdECTwdRw8nRCQP9ZupHnRLJD7Fw57wn